Why Summer Temperatures Can Affect Refrigerator Performance
Southern California is known for long stretches of warm weather, especially in cities like Los Angeles, Beverly Hills, Santa Monica, Pasadena, and surrounding communities. During extreme heat, every refrigerator has to work harder to maintain the proper internal temperature.
Sub-Zero refrigerators are engineered for premium performance, but they are still subject to the laws of physics. When ambient temperatures rise significantly, the refrigeration system cycles more frequently to remove heat entering the cabinet. If any component is beginning to wear out or airflow is restricted, the additional demand of summer can expose problems that may have gone unnoticed during cooler seasons.
Many homeowners first notice that beverages are not as cold, dairy products spoil faster than expected, or the refrigerator seems to be running almost continuously.

Common Reasons a Sub-Zero Refrigerator Becomes Too Warm
Several conditions can contribute to poor cooling performance during summer.
Dirty condenser coils are among the most common causes. Dust, pet hair, and debris reduce the system’s ability to release heat efficiently. As the outdoor temperature climbs, clogged coils make cooling even more difficult.
Poor airflow around the appliance can also reduce performance. Built-in refrigerators require adequate ventilation. Cabinets packed too tightly or blocked vents can trap heat around critical components.
Door seals that no longer create a proper seal may allow warm air to enter continuously. During summer, this extra heat infiltration forces the refrigeration system to work much harder.
A malfunctioning evaporator fan can prevent cold air from circulating throughout the fresh food compartment. Even if cooling is being produced, uneven distribution may leave some sections noticeably warmer.
Temperature sensors or electronic controls can develop faults over time. Incorrect readings may prevent the compressor from operating as needed.
The compressor itself or other sealed system components may also be experiencing reduced efficiency. These highly technical systems require specialized tools and expertise for proper diagnosis.
Signs That Your Refrigerator Needs Professional Service
Many homeowners wonder whether their refrigerator is simply working harder because of the weather or if something is actually wrong.
If the motor seems to run almost constantly, if food spoils faster than expected, if condensation develops inside the cabinet, or if the refrigerator struggles to recover after the door has been opened, professional inspection is recommended.
Some owners also notice unusual noises, inconsistent temperatures between shelves, or frost developing in unexpected areas. These symptoms often indicate mechanical or airflow issues rather than normal seasonal operation.

How Delaying Repairs Can Make the Situation Worse
A refrigerator that is only slightly warm today may stop cooling entirely tomorrow.
As components struggle under increased workload, additional parts can become stressed and eventually fail. Food loss can become significant, especially in households storing premium groceries, medications, specialty ingredients, or wine collections.
Extended operation under abnormal conditions may also shorten the lifespan of major components. What begins as restricted airflow or a failing fan motor can eventually place unnecessary strain on the compressor.
Prompt service often helps identify developing issues before they cascade into more extensive repairs.

Keeping Your Sub-Zero Performing Through Southern California Summers
Preventive maintenance plays an important role in year-round reliability.
Keeping condenser areas clean, ensuring proper airflow around the appliance, minimizing unnecessary door openings during extreme heat, and addressing unusual noises or temperature fluctuations early can all help maintain optimal performance.
Routine inspections also allow developing issues to be identified before they affect food preservation.
